About the role
- Define and prioritize the product roadmap in partnership with stakeholders (engineering, design, marketing, operations)
- Break down high-level goals into user stories and detailed requirements
- Facilitate Agile ceremonies (sprint planning, stand-ups, retrospectives) and drive continuous improvement
- Track progress using Linear and communicate status to leadership
- Collaborate closely with engineers to balance technical constraints and business needs
- Analyze market trends, user feedback, and performance metrics to inform product decisions
- Write clear, concise documentation (specs, release notes, process guides) in English
Requirements
- 2+ Years in Product Management of a software product, ideally in a startup or marketplace environment
- Agile Project Management: Proven experience managing products in an Agile/Scrum environment
- Tool Proficiency: Hands-on with Linear, Jira, or equivalent issue-tracking and roadmapping tools
- Communication: Excellent written and verbal English skills; comfortable presenting to global stakeholders
- Technical Savvy: Solid understanding of web architectures, APIs, and common tech stacks
- Collaborative Mindset: Ability to work cross-functionally and influence without direct authority
- Nice-to-Haves Familiarity with Next.js or PHP codebases (even at a high level) Experience working with AWS (e.g., EC2, Lambda, RDS) or other cloud platforms Previous background in marketplaces or e-commerce products Passion for cycling and outdoor sports
